DRAMATIC PRICE REDUCTION! This 2003 Larson 254 Cabrio in Stamford, CT – powered by a 260 hp Volvo Penta 5.7GL is well maintained and in excellent condition.
The patented Duo-Delta Conic hull sets the Cabrio apart from traditional V-hulls, delivering quicker planing and a smooth, stable, drier ride. At speed, the wetted surface is significantly less than a V-hull, resulting in less drag, higher speed and enhanced fuel economy.
Built to the highest standards, this boat is ISO 9001 compliant, featuring knitted 36 oz multi-axial fiberglass construction for more strength but less weight – double and triple matting at stess points provides protection from torsional twisting. Stainless steel hardware is secured with bolts & locks with backing plates.
The cockpit is made for lounging or entertaining. Helm features fore & aft seat that folds down to create a comfy sun lounge. To port is a chaise, with a built-in ice cooler at it’s foot. Removable aft seating, snap-in carpet and walk-through transom with gate complete this well laid-out cockpit.
Swim platform features hot & cold fresh water shower and walk-through windshield offers easy access to the bow for mooring or docking.
Sleep 4 below – 2 in huge forward convertible dinette berth, 2 in the full-size private mid-cabin berth.
The galley has a microwave, refrigerator, sink with spray handle faucet, and single-burner stove. The enclosed head includes a shower.
Other goodies include a 19” flat screen TV with DVD player, stereo and underwater transom lights and full camper canvas.

The Biggest Pros and Cons

The 2003 Larson 254 Cabrio offers a blend of comfort, style, and performance, making it a popular choice for recreational boating. Here are some of the pros and cons to consider:

Pros

Spacious Cabin: The 254 Cabrio features a well-designed cabin with enough space to comfortably accommodate overnight guests, making it great for weekend trips.

Versatile Layout: With a convertible cockpit and ample seating, it’s suitable for both day cruising and entertaining.

Quality Construction: Larson boats are known for solid build quality and durability.

Good Performance: Equipped with a reliable inboard/outboard engine, the boat provides smooth handling and decent speed.

Amenities: The model typically includes a galley, head, and sleeping accommodations, offering convenience for extended outings.

Cons

Maintenance Costs: Like many older boats, upkeep can be costly, especially if the engine or other systems haven't been regularly serviced.

Fuel Efficiency: The 254 Cabrio may consume more fuel compared to smaller or more modern vessels.

Limited Storage: While the cabin is spacious, storage compartments can be somewhat limited for longer trips.

Aging Electronics: Original factory-installed electronics and navigation gear might be outdated and require upgrades.

Weight: The boat’s weight can affect trailering ease and fuel consumption.
